  • National roads in France: history, geography and layout

    National roads in France: history, geography and layout

    France’s national roads, a legacy of the Ancien Régime and the royal and imperial roads, remain an essential link in the road network. At a time of regionalisation and new mobility challenges, they reveal a history, organisation and use that shape the daily life and territory of France.

  • Map of France of eternal pollutants (PFAS)

    Map of France of eternal pollutants (PFAS)

    PFAS, also known as eternal pollutants, are very persistent chemical substances that are present everywhere, including in water in France. Find out more about the state of play, the health risks and the unique national mapping tool for a better understanding of this pollution.
